Kit Kat & Lucy

DuPont, Lonnie Hull. Kit Kat & Lucy: The Country Cats Who Changed a City Girl’s World. Grand Rapids, MI: Revell Publishing. 2016.

kitkatlucy

SUMMARY:
As a memoir of the changes in her life brought on by two cats, Kit Kat and Lucy, author Lonnie Hull DuPont recounts the pieces of her life shaped by cats. Full of humor, compassion, poignancy and memories, Kit Kat & Lucy take the author (and readers) on a heartwarming journey. As an author of several animal stories, she still shares her home and heart with cats.

A PENNY FOR MY THOUGHTS:
I was originally drawn to this book by the title and cover which includes two very handsome kitties. Perhaps expecting something a bit different, I did struggle just a little with the mixed, short stories forming the overall larger story. Though well written, in places I had trouble connecting the tales, which in turn caused some dissonance for me. Liking the healing and helping nature of the cats for the author; however, I did appreciate her willingness to share her story.

RATING:
3.5 (out of 5) pennies

The Christmas Cat

Carlson, Melody. The Christmas Cat. Grand Rapids, MI: Revell Publishing. 2014.

SUMMARY:
catGarrison Brown, insanely allergic to cats, must find suitable homes for his recently deceased Grandmother’s six (yes, six) cats. With initial interviews, home visits and follow-up appointments necessary, Garrison wonders if he will ever place all the kitties. With a surprise “insurance” check included when each cat is settled into a loving home, Garrison soon finds himself attached to the Maine Coon, Harry. And could it be? His new neighbor, Cara, may be just the perfect home for Harry…what would Gram think?

A PENNY FOR MY THOUGHTS:
Having read each of Melody Carlson’s Christmas novels each year, it has almost become a tradition to anticipate the next one. With a few cats myself as well as a mom with plenty of her own, I was excited to read The Christmas Cat. Truly an adorable, faith-filled, sweet Christmas story, I was not disappointed. Melody Carlson had me with the stunning cover and kept me reading to the end. Especially heart-warming was the dedication to Harry, the Maine Coon cat, who found the author in the middle of winter and worked his way into her heart…aaww! I look forward to next year’s Christmas book addition to my tradition!

RATING:
4.5 (out of 5) pennies

You’re the Cat’s Meow

Johnson, Julie. You’re the Cat’s Meow. Eugene, OR: Harvest House Publishers. 2013.

SUMMARY:
catsmeowAlong with describing different cat personalities (friendly, sweet, elegant, companion), Julie Johnson adds charming pictures of cats in all shapes, sizes, colors and patterns. Partnered with classic quotes and thoughts, each page of verse and pictures lend to an absolutely adorable book. Perfect for cat lovers everywhere, this book is set up as a gift book including a presenter page.

A PENNY FOR MY THOUGHTS:
A delightful book which celebrates cat friendships, I truly enjoyed it. Perhaps being a cat lover myself, I could relate to the verses, pictures and pure enjoyment filling the pages. Having recently reviewed Julie Johnson’s other book, A Friendship to Bark About, I was excited to see if this book was just as captivating…and it definitely is!! A wonderful reminder why cats rule, perfect as a memorial, ideal for a new cat-parent, or even as a tool for teaching animal kindness, You’re the Cat’s Meow will not disappoint.

RATING:
4.5 (out of 5) pennies
